The easiest way (I found) to setup TensorFlow on your system is by using a Docker install. Its advantages are that it just works out of the box, all dependencies are there and you can start building deep models within minutes! Warning: it does not allow you to accelerate the learning on a GPU though!!
So here are the steps required (on Mac):
- Download Docker (documentation) from
- Install Docker
- Open a Terminal
- Run the TensorFlow install by:
docker run -it gcr.io/tensorflow/tensorflow bash